#cf0fe2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cf0fe2 is composed of 81.2% red, 5.9%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.4% cyan, 93.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 294.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 47.3%. #cf0fe2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1eff with #9f00c5.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#cf0fe2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050005 is the darkest color, while #fdf2fe is the lightest one.
